On average across the year,
yes, Costa Rica is hotter than
Highlands Ranch, Colorado
.
Costa Rica has an average temperature of 25°C/77°F and Highlands Ranch, Colorado has an average temperature of 11°C/52°F.
Costa Rica's hottest month is April, with an average maximum temperature of 32°C/90°F, which is hotter than Highlands Ranch, Colorado's hottest month (July, with an average maximum temperature of 31°C/88°F).
On average across the year, no, Costa Rica is not colder than Highlands Ranch, Colorado . Costa Rica has an average minimum temperature of 20°C/68°F and Highlands Ranch, Colorado has an average minimum temperature of 3°C/37°F.
On average across the year,
yes, Costa Rica has more rain than
Highlands Ranch, Colorado. Costa Rica has an average annual rainfall of 1358mm and Highlands Ranch, Colorado has an average annual rainfall of 395mm.
Costa Rica's wettest month is October, with an average monthly rainfall of 212mm, which is wetter than Highlands Ranch, Colorado's wettest month (May, with an average monthly rainfall of 71mm).
